Answer to Question 1

C
Explanation: A) A psychotic person cannot tell the difference between reality and unreality.
B) An agoraphobic is afraid to be in crowded public places.
C) Correct.
D) A pyromania has an impulsive disorder consisting of a compulsion to set fires or to watch fires.

Answer to Question 2

D
Explanation: D) Correct. The root psych means mind and the root iatr means treatment.
